Description

The SAM Finger Splint is a compact, durable solution for immobilizing and protecting injured fingers. Designed with the same reliable materials as the original SAM splints, this splint features a lightweight aluminum core laminated with soft foam for maximum comfort and effective support.

Its bright blue/orange color ensures easy visibility in emergency settings. The moldable design allows for custom shaping to conform to any finger, making it suitable for a wide range of finger injuries such as sprains, dislocations, or fractures. Ideal for first aid kits, athletic trainers, or clinical use.
